The nurse is concerned that a proposed health program lacks sufficient support for global health. What should be included in this program? (Select all that apply.)
 
  1. Prevention activities
  2. Strategic partnerships
  3. Income measurements
  4. Responses to local needs
  5. Evidence-based knowledge

Answer to Question 1

Correct Answer: 1, 2, 4, 5

The principles of global health have been described in various national and international documents, including the Global Health Strategy of the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services Strategic Plan 2010-2015. The underlying principles of global health include: using evidence-based knowledge to inform decisions; leveraging strengths through partnership and coordination; responding to local needs; building local capacities; ensuring a lasting, measurable impact, emphasizing prevention; and improving health equity. Income measurement is not a principle of global health.

Answer to Question 2

Correct Answer: 1

Primary health care is an approach to health that includes a spectrum of services extending beyond the traditional health-care system. It encompasses all services that influence the determinants of health, such as income, housing, education, and the environment. Embedded within primary health care is primary care, which focuses on healthcare services and is a major component of nursing student studies, including health promotion, illness and injury prevention, and the diagnosis and treatment of illness and injury. The five domains of primary health care articulated in the Declaration of Alma-Ata are accessibility and equitable distribution, community participation, health promotion, appropriate technology, and intersectoral collaboration. Teaching about medications for tuberculosis is the appropriate use of technology. Addressing water issues is intersectoral collaboration. Extending clinic hours supports accessibility and equitable distribution. Use of a free-lunch program supports health promotion.
